Six years after the world caught of glimpse of part of Janet Jackson’s birthday suit, the infamous Waldrobe Malfunction, as the incident became known, is back in the courtroom. The U.S. Supreme Court has asked a lower court to reinstate the fine of $550,000 to CBS, a fine that was dismissed in 2008 for being [...]

Janet Jackson was in Milan last night to host an AIDS benefit for amFar. Janet addressed the audience, saying, “Please enjoy this special evening, please keep fighting and please, this battle needs all of us to be brave warriors. Thank you very much, God bless, have a good evening.”
